About this app

★ The Torch App instantly turns your device into a powerful LED flashlight. The app is very simple to use, just 3 switches and a widget that you can add to your home screen to control the flashlight. ★

Who needs a flashlight in the daylight? This app is set to Dark/Night Mode, to protect your eyes in the night, and your phone's battery too!

Key Features
• Camera LED
• Bright Screen
• Strobe Light
• Dark Mode (AMOLED Support t save battery)

Settings
• Hide Flashlight
• Hide Strobe Light
• Toggle Vibration

Why Try
• Includes a Widget with a customizable color choice
• No Ads, internet or any other shady features
• 1 permission (Camera needed for Strobe feature)
• App is completely free
• Under 1 MB in storage size
• Battery Saver (Marshmallow and Nougat devices use the new Flashlight API, which is designed to save your phone valuable battery life)

Notes:
• *For Samsung Galaxy Nexus, the regular torch isn't supported, nonetheless the strobe feature and bright screen still perform fine.
• It is recommended to uninstall any previously installed 3rd party flashlight apps to avoid compatibility issues.
